About This Book
Cliff diving isn't just a sport—it's a heart-pounding adventure where brave athletes leap off towering rocks into deep blue waters below. Discover the daring tricks and fearless challenges that make cliff diving one of the most exciting sports around. It’s a splash of courage and skill that will leave you amazed!
Quick Assessment
This early reader introduces young children to the thrilling world of cliff diving, highlighting the sport's techniques, challenges, and notable athletes. Suitable for ages 5-8, it combines engaging text with vivid images to inspire curiosity about sports while emphasizing safety and courage. The content is appropriate with no concerning themes.
